Asp进阶实战:站长效率极速提升指南
|
Asp(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中逐渐被更先进的框架所取代,但其在某些传统系统或遗留项目中仍然具有重要价值。对于站长而言,掌握Asp进阶技巧能够显著提升网站管理效率。 熟悉Asp的核心对象是提升效率的基础。例如Response对象用于控制输出内容,Request对象处理用户输入,Session和Application对象则用于管理会话和全局变量。合理使用这些对象可以减少重复代码,提高程序的可维护性。 在实际应用中,数据库操作是站长日常工作的重点。通过Asp连接Access、SQL Server等数据库,利用ADO(ActiveX Data Objects)实现数据读取、插入、更新和删除。优化查询语句和合理使用缓存机制,能够有效提升页面响应速度。 文件操作也是Asp的重要功能之一。站长可以通过FileSystemObject对象实现文件的创建、读取、写入和删除。例如,生成静态页面、备份日志文件或动态生成内容,都能通过Asp实现自动化处理。 安全性是网站管理中不可忽视的部分。Asp中常见的安全问题包括SQL注入、跨站脚本攻击等。通过参数化查询、输入验证和过滤机制,可以有效降低风险。合理设置权限和使用服务器组件也能增强系统的安全性。
2026AI生成内容,仅供参考 掌握调试工具和日志记录方法对提升效率至关重要。使用Response.Write进行调试虽简单,但结合专业的调试器和日志记录,能更快定位问题,节省大量排查时间。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

